There are a lot of alternatives. Some of them would never be enacted. Some I'd like to see tried.
What unfortunately is NOT feasible is getting rid of taxes of one sort or another. Not in a civilization this large which depends on infrastructure that requires maintenance, and one that is made up of human beings and thus subject to the Free Rider problem and the related Prisoner's Dilemma.
One of the few beliefs I held when younger that actually significantly changed was this one; I used to believe it would be possible to abolish taxes entirely. Alas, I was finally convinced that the Free Rider problem would be significant enough in any large society to make that an impractical dream.
